[実行]メニュー への移動
実行 > プロセスの読み込み... > ローカル
アプリケーションに渡すコマンドライン パラメータの入力、DLL をテストするためのホスト実行可能ファイルの指定、選択したデバッガへの実行可能ファイルの読み込みなどを行います。
項目
|
説明
|
[デバッガ]
|
使用するデバッガを以下から選択します:
- Embarcadero Windows 32 ビット デバッガ は、32 ビット Windows アプリケーション用のデフォルトの組み込みデバッガです。
- Embarcadero Windows 64 ビット デバッガ は、64 ビット Windows がターゲット プラットフォームである Delphi アプリケーションのデバッグ用に特化して設計されており、式の評価時に、Delphi のデバッグ情報や Delphi の構文を認識します。
- Embarcadero Windows 64 ビット LLDB デバッガ for C++ は、64 ビット Windows がターゲット プラットフォームである C++ アプリケーションのデバッグ用に特化して設計されており、式の評価時に、C++ のデバッグ情報や C++ の構文を認識します。
- Embarcadero macOS 64 ビット デバッガ は、64 ビット Intel macOS アプリケーション用デバッガです。
- Embarcadero macOS ARM 64 ビット デバッガ は、64 ビット ARM macOS アプリケーション用デバッガです。
- Embarcadero Linux 64 ビット デバッガ は、64 ビット Intel Linux アプリケーション用デバッガです。
- Embarcadero iOS デバイス 64 ビット デバッガ は、64 ビット iOS デバイス アプリケーション用デバッガです。
メモ: [プロセスの読み込み|環境ブロック] は、Embarcadero iOS デバイス デバッガ ではサポートされていません。
- Embarcadero Android 32 ビット デバッガ は、32 ビット Android デバイス アプリケーション用デバッガです。
- Embarcadero Android 64 ビット デバッガ は、64 ビット Android デバイス アプリケーション用デバッガです。
メモ: [プロセスの読み込み|環境ブロック] は、Embarcadero Android デバッガ ではサポートされていません。
|
[プロセス]
|
デバッガで実行したい実行可能(.EXE )ファイルの、ファイル名まで含む完全パス名を入力します。 その後、[読み込み]をクリックすると、その実行可能ファイルが読み込まれます。 実行可能ファイルはエントリ ポイントで一時停止します。 エントリ ポイントでデバッグ情報がなければ、[CPU]ウィンドウが開きます。 [実行|実行]を選択すると、実行可能ファイルを実行できます。 [参照...]をクリックすると、ディレクトリおよび実行可能ファイルを検索できます。
|
[パラメータ]
|
アプリケーションの起動時に渡すコマンドライン引数を入力します。
|
[作業ディレクトリ]
|
デバッグ プロセスで使用するディレクトリの名前を入力します。デフォルトでは、アプリケーションの実行可能ファイルが含まれているディレクトリと同じになります。
|
[ソース パス]
|
実行可能ファイルのビルドに使用するソース ファイルのパスを指定します。
|
[読み込み後]
|
プロセスの読み込み後に実行するコードがあれば、それを指定します。次のオプションの中から選択してください。
[実行しない]
|
[実行|トレース実行](F7)でデバッグセッションを開始するのと同じです。
|
実行可能ファイルを読み込みますが、実行はしません。
|
[プログラム エントリ ポイントまで実行する]
|
[実行|ステップ実行](F8)でデバッグセッションを開始するのと同じです。
|
C++ の場合のみ有効です。main() などの最初のエントリ ポイントまで実行されます。
|
[最初のソースまで実行する]
|
[実行|次の行まで実行](Shift+F7)でデバッグセッションを開始するのと同じです。
|
最初のソース行まで実行されます。
|
[実行する]
|
[実行|実行](F9)でデバッグセッションを開始するのと同じです。
|
プロセスは、デバッガの制御下で最後まで実行されます。
|
|
関連項目